Hi all — handing over the Quillgate release. We shipped the circuit breaker wrapping the Tarnow upstream API in 2.9; it trips after five consecutive 5xx responses and half-opens after thirty seconds. Plugin authors: your retry logic should respect the breaker state exposed via `quillgate.breaker.status`. Staging soak looked clean over the weekend. If you're publishing a plugin update against this release, sign it before upload. The current signing key is:

deploy key for tadug-tafog: bky3_hqi

## Deployment: Cold starts

Handlers on the Fennelrun platform are provisioned on demand, so the first invocation after idle incurs a cold start of roughly 400–900 ms depending on bundle size. Plugin authors should keep initialization code outside the handler body minimal and defer heavy imports until first use. Fennelrun can keep a small pool of warm instances per handler to absorb traffic spikes; warming is opt-in and billed separately. The warming pool size, idle timeout, and related knobs are controlled by the values below.

service settings:
PRAWYN_PIN=9848
PRAWYN_METRICS_HOST=metrics.prawyn.lumicworks.corp
PRAWYN_LOG_LEVEL=warn
PRAWYN_TENANT=pelius

- [ ] Verify Brightledger report exports render correct local times for workspaces spanning daylight-saving boundaries. Export the Kelmont sample workspace in three zones, compare row timestamps against the UTC source table, and confirm no double-offset drift. Sign off only after all three match. Record your verification against the build token below.

pipeline stamp: htk31_f769b577b3028a4e9958e5bb8d1259a

## Runbook: Typosquat Scanner (Lanternfish)

Lanternfish scans the internal package mirror hourly for names within edit distance two of approved packages. Alerts page the on-call channel with the suspect name and publisher. Quarantined packages stay blocked until security review. Flagged entries are recorded in the findings table, reachable via the connection string below.

primary connection of yagep-kahip = redis://giliel_svc:zYiKsLL2PLpfPL@db-348f.xolmarsys.corp:5432/fenwyn